Top 10 Most Popular Human Resource Management Schools
Our 2023 rankings named The University of Tennessee - Knoxville the most popular school in Tennessee for human resource management students. Located in the midsize city of Knoxville, UT Knoxville is a public college with a fairly large student population.
While working on their degree, hr majors at UT Knoxville accumulate an average of around $20,248 in student debt.

Human Resource Management Related Majors
One of 21 majors within the business area of study, human resource management has other similar majors worth exploring.
HR Concentrations
| Major | Annual Graduates |
|---|---|
| General Human Resources Management/Personnel Administration | 18,023 |
| Organizational Behavior Studies | 3,650 |
| Human Resources Development | 2,083 |
| Labor & Industrial Relations | 1,778 |
| Other Human Resources Management and Services | 1,254 |
| Labor Studies | 193 |
| Executive/Career Coaching | 93 |
